         <title>Function-</title>
         <author>200097751</author>
         <link>https://padlet.com/200097751/carbohydrate/wish/436127116</link>
         <description><![CDATA[<div>1.<strong>Causes Biochemical reactions =&gt;</strong></div><ul><li>Enzymes are proteins,</li><li>The structure of enzymes allow them to combine with other molecules inside the cell called substrate </li><li>which catalyze reactions that are essential to your metabolism</li></ul><div>2. <strong>Acts as Messenger</strong>=)</div><ul><li>Some proteins are hormones </li><li>Which are chemical messenger that aid communication between your cells, tissue and organ </li></ul><div><br></div>]]></description>
